Comment (by SimonKing):
Here is another possibility to speed things up: Replace itertools.count()
by a cpdef method, defined in some auxiliary file.
Timing:
{{{
sage: cython("""
cdef long counter = 0
cpdef count1():
global counter
counter += 1
return counter
def count2():
cdef long c = 0
while True:
c += 1
yield c
""")
sage: C = count1
sage: %timeit a = C()
10000000 loops, best of 3: 73.8 ns per loop
sage: C = count2()
sage: %timeit a = C.next()
1000000 loops, best of 3: 252 ns per loop
sage: import itertools
sage: C = itertools.count()
sage: %timeit a = C.next()
1000000 loops, best of 3: 231 ns per loop
}}}
Note that this would also make the startup_module plugin happy, since it
complains about the new import of itertools during startup.
